    Abstract: The double door security device uses at least two opposed hinges of the double door pair to secure corresponding door bar retainers to the door frame structure. The hinge pin is removed and the door bar retainer is placed upon the hinge, with a hinge pin of suitable length reinstalled through the hinge to secure the door bar retainer pivotally to the hinge. The door bar retainer, in combination with the hinge, defines a door bar passage for the removable installation of a door bar therethrough. The retainers may be configured to accept door bars having various cross sectional shapes, e.g. two by four lumber, square and round tubing and pipe, etc. The hinge attachment ends of the retainers are preferably beveled to minimize marring of the door and door frame adjacent to the hinge, and to serve as a door stop limiting the opening swing of the door.

    Abstract: A rest for a firearm or the like that attaches to the sling swivel on the forearm of the firearm. Said rest is comprised of two major assemblies. First assembly attaches to the sling swivel and provides a surrogate sling swivel and a female receptacle for the second assembly. Second assembly consists of male protrusion that mates with first assembly and two lightweight legs that can be quickly assembled and disassembled. Said rest allows quick attachment and detachment in the field. With a static leg position, said rest allows the ability to move the muzzle of the firearm in a conical motion, and randomly within the confines of the cone, while concurrently adjusting the cant of the rifle.
